Third Sunday Guest Speaker and Recipient 

The local nonprofit organization featured this Sunday will be Court Appointed Special Advocates, also known for short as CASA. CASA furnishes support to children and teenagers involved in court proceedings that might not fully recognize the best interests of these youth.
